    Red Rock Brewery, or Red Rock Brewing Co., is a brewery founded in 1994 and based in Salt Lake City, Utah, United States. [1] [2]The flagship brewery is located in Salt Lake’s Marmalade District, between 200 South and 300 South, [3] with additional Utah locations in the Fashion Place Mall in Murray and Kimball Junction near Park City.

    KBDX now operates with its own dominant Red Rock 92 format, with ABC news on the hour and a meteorologist. The Red Rock format is a blend of 1970s and 80s pop hits, and is the only format of its kind in the Four Corners. It has a very wide coverage area from south of Shiprock, New Mexico, and can be easily heard north of Moab, Utah.

    KENZ (94.9 FM, Power 94.9 / 101.9) is a commercial radio station licensed to Provo, Utah and serving the Salt Lake City metropolitan area. It broadcasts a contemporary hit radio format simulcast with 101.9 KHTB Ogden and is owned and operated by Cumulus Media. [2] [3] The radio studios are located in South Salt Lake, near the I-15/I-80 interchange.

    The Great Salt Lake is the largest saltwater lake in the Western Hemisphere [1] and the eighth-largest terminal lake in the world. [2] It lies in the northern part of the U.S. state of Utah and has a substantial impact upon the local climate, particularly through lake-effect snow.

    KAAZ-FM (106.7 MHz, "Rock 106.7") is a mainstream rock formatted radio station broadcasting to the Salt Lake City metropolitan area. The station's city of license is Spanish Fork, Utah. [3] The station is owned by iHeartMedia, Inc.. [4]
